N. T. Wright explains how God called a covenant people so that through them the world may be put to rights. Wright shows how "justification" happens by the "faithfulness of Jesus the Messiah" and how we respond with covenant faithfulness. We, the people of God, have been set right in advance-- in anticipation-- of the whole world being one day set right.
